In 1806, Hugh Brewster entered the world in South Carolina, USA, born to Colonel William Brewster And Margaret Dempsey. In 1840, Hugh Brewster resided in Beyar, Coweta, Georgia, United States. In 1843, Hugh Brewster resided in Beyar, Coweta, Georgia, United States. Hugh Brewster married Harlow E T Beedles, Sarah Townsend, and had children including Daniel Brewster, Dorthula Brewster, Edmund Thompson Brewster, Ellen Ora Brewster, Eugene Douglas Brewster, Hugh L Brewster, Mary D Brewster, Parthena Brewster, Sallie Brewster, Walter C Brewster, William A Brewster. Hugh Brewster passed away in 1872 in Newnan, Coweta County, Georgia, USA.
